Outgoing Email Scanning could be interfering with your sending, especially if your ISP requires that you use a port other than port 25. Turning off outgoing scans has no bearing on your PC's security, so simply disablling this might fix the issue. I don't know why Antiphishing would be involved, since it is only concerned with incoming messages. You may be able to turn that back on. Messages getting stuck in the Outbox is not uncommon - you may want to try some of the troubleshooting steps suggested by Microsoft here:
